Choosing the Right Piece for Your Space

When selecting an antique corner cabinet curved glass, consider both dimensions and proportions carefully. Measure your corner space thoroughly, accounting for wall irregularities and any architectural features like baseboards or outlets that might affect placement. The height of the piece should complement surrounding furniture without appearing dwarfed or overwhelming.

Examine the condition of the glass panels closely. Minor imperfections can add character, but cracks or significant clouding may require professional restoration. Check the door hinges and closure mechanisms to ensure they function smoothly. Solid wood construction with dovetail joints indicates superior craftsmanship and longevity.

Care and Maintenance Tips

Proper care ensures your antique corner cabinet curved glass remains beautiful for decades. Dust regularly with a soft, lint-free cloth to prevent buildup that can dull both the wood and glass surfaces. Avoid harsh cleaning chemicals that might damage the finish or cloud the glass over time.

Protect the piece from direct sunlight exposure, which can cause wood to fade and dry out. Maintain consistent humidity levels in your home to prevent warping or cracking of the wooden components. Apply a quality furniture polish every few months to nourish the wood and enhance its natural luster.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I determine if my antique corner cabinet curved glass is authentic?

Look for hand-cut dovetail joints, natural wood grain variations, and age-appropriate hardware. Check for maker's marks or labels inside drawers or on the back panel. Authentic pieces often show consistent wear patterns that align with their age and usage history.

What types of items work best for display in a corner cabinet with curved glass?

Crystal glassware, fine china, vintage books, collectible figurines, and decorative bowls all showcase beautifully through curved glass panels. The transparency allows you to appreciate your collection without removing pieces from the cabinet.

Can I use an antique corner cabinet curved glass in a modern setting?

Absolutely. The contrast between antique craftsmanship and contemporary design often creates striking visual interest. Many interior designers specifically incorporate vintage pieces into modern spaces for this reason.

How should I position my corner cabinet to maximize its visual impact?

Place it where natural light can illuminate the curved glass, such as near a window or under recessed lighting. Ensure there is adequate clearance for door opening and that the piece aligns properly with adjacent furniture pieces.

What common restoration issues might affect antique corner cabinets with curved glass?

Common issues include loose hinges, warped wooden frames, clouded or cracked glass panels, and finish deterioration. Most of these can be addressed by experienced furniture restorers at reasonable costs.
